EU Trade Chief Presses for March Approval of US Deal (1)

Feb. 24, 2026, 2:43 PM UTC

The European Union’s trade chief urged the bloc’s lawmakers to approve a trade deal with the US in March, as long as there is certainty by then on President Donald Trump’s new tariff plans.

“A vote in plenary in March must remain our target, under the condition, of course, that we get more clarity from the United States,” Maros Sefcovic told the European Parliament’s trade committee on Tuesday.
